French bee is undoubtedly doing something both unusual and bold for a relatively small carrier. The airline is sending its fleet of 480-seat Airbus A350-1000 jets across the Atlantic to Newark Liberty International Airport (EWR). This long-haul service is one of the densest twin-engine operations in the United States market. Since Newark also sees no scheduled Airbus A380 flights, this makes the flight the airport’s highest-capacity passenger service.
